A massive wildfire was last night raging in the hills above Ahipara forcing the evacuation of multiple homes just hours before a total fire ban was due to come into force across Northland.
The alarm
was raised about 5.45pm yesterday with the Ahipara and Kaitaia brigades the first to respond, backed up by four helicopters using monsoon buckets.
The Ahipara fire from 90 Mile Beach. Photo / Paul Sutton
The fire was in the Gumfields Historic Reserve immediately above the west coast settlement which is currently packed with holidaymakers. ....

Cloudy periods and a few showers should be all Northlanders have to deal with as they celebrate New Year s.
Tomorrow, MetService is predicting cloudy periods, light winds with a high of 25 degrees Celsius across Northland. On New Year s Day, similar conditions were expected, however, there was a chance of rain as westerly breezes pushed a front across the region.
There s not too much to worry about, MetService meteorologist Lewis Ferris said. ....

A smouldering scrub fire on Northland s coast had to be monitored overnight due to fears the large blaze started by a ride-on lawnmower could be revived by windy conditions.
The fire in Waipu Cove - while accidental - was an important reminder about the dangers fires sparked in the current dry conditions can pose for the region, Muri Whenua area manager Wipari Henwood said. ....

A total fire ban in Whangārei and Kaipara has been put in place due to high-risk fire conditions.
Fire and Emergency principal rural fire officer Myles Taylor says the ban, effective from 8am on December 24, means no open-air fires are allowed.
It s very important people follow the fire ban and don t light any outside fires or let off fireworks, he says.
It s too risky. In the current hot and dry conditions a stray ember or firework could easily start a fire which would quickly spread. ....
